{ "info": { "author": "C. W.", "author_email": "wangc_2011@hotmail.com", "bugtrack_url": null, "classifiers": [ "Intended Audience :: Developers", "Programming Language :: Python", "Programming Language :: Python :: 2.6",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.3", "Programming Language :: Python :: 3.4",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6", "Topic :: Office/Business", "Topic :: Software Development :: Libraries", "Topic :: Utilities" ], "description": "================================================================================\ngease - gITHUB RELease\n================================================================================\n\n.. image:: https://api.travis-ci.org/moremoban/gease.svg?branch=master\n :target: http://travis-ci.org/moremoban/gease\n\n.. image:: https://codecov.io/gh/moremoban/gease/branch/master/graph/badge.svg\n :target: https://codecov.io/gh/moremoban/gease\n\n\n::\n\n A long long time ago, ancient developers do not have the command to do a github\n release. They relied on mouse clicks and web user interface to do their releases.\n Until 2017, they got a specialized command, **gs** and realized release management\n is no long a manual job.\n\n**gease** simply makes a git release using github api v3.\n\n.. image:: https://github.com/moremoban/gease/raw/master/images/cli.png\n :width: 600px\n\n\nInstallation\n================================================================================\n\n\nYou can install gease via pip:\n\n.. code-block:: bash\n\n $ pip install gease\n\n\nor clone it and install it:\n\n.. code-block:: bash\n\n $ git clone https://github.com/moremoban/gease.git\n $ cd gease\n $ python setup.py install\n\nSetup and Configuration\n================================================================================\n\nFirst, please create `personal access token` for yourself\n`on github `_.\n\n.. image:: https://github.com/moremoban/gease/raw/master/images/generate_token.png\n\nNext, please create a gease file(`.gease`) in your home directory and place the\ntoken inside it. Gease file is a simple json file. Here is an example::\n\n {\"user\":\"chfw\",\"personal_access_token\":\"AAFDAFASDFADFADFADFADFADF\"}\n\nCommand Line\n================================================================================\n\n::\n\n gease simply makes a git release using github api v3. version 0.0.1\n\n Usage: gs repo tag [release message]\n\n where:\n\n release message is optional. It could be a quoted string or space separate\n\t string\n\n Examples:\n\n gs gease v0.0.1 first great release\n gs gease v0.0.2 \"second great release\"\n\n\nLicense\n================================================================================\n\nMIT\n\n\nChange log\n===========\n\nv0.0.3 - 25.11.2017\n--------------------------------------------------------------------------------\n\nadded\n********************************************************************************\n\n#. `issue 1`_, release repos of the\n organisation that you belong to.\n\nv0.0.2 - 15.10.2017\n--------------------------------------------------------------------------------\n\nupdated\n********************************************************************************\n\n#. quit with -1 if github responds with error\n\n\nv0.0.1 - 13.10.2017\n--------------------------------------------------------------------------------\n\nFirst release. Make a release from command line\n\n\n", "description_content_type": null, "docs_url": null, "download_url": "https://github.com/moremoban/gease/archive/0.0.3.tar.gz",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/moremoban/gease", "keywords": "python", "license": "MIT", "maintainer": "", "maintainer_email": "", "name": "gease", "package_url": "https://pypi.org/project/gease/", "platform": "", "project_url": "https://pypi.org/project/gease/", "project_urls": { "Download": "https://github.com/moremoban/gease/archive/0.0.3.tar.gz", "Homepage": "https://github.com/moremoban/gease" }, "release_url": "https://pypi.org/project/gease/0.0.3/", "requires_dist": null, "requires_python": "", "summary": "simply makes a git release using github api v3", "version": "0.0.3" }, "last_serial": 3362658, "releases": { "0.0.1": [ { "comment_text": "", "digests": { "md5": "f5fcf99422dc696707425618f3f20f89", "sha256": "2add50ce129b5dedf3fbacd33a9bc35f1b56a3af755f21ec7572b56902949359" }, "downloads": -1, "filename": "gease-0.0.1-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"f5fcf99422dc696707425618f3f20f89",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 8637, "upload_time": "2017-10-13T20:40:27", "url": "https://files.pythonhosted.org/packages/33/bf/4d385e053306f703b1b2efc91c1917f682467f9a9cc6b9f7ae72b62ec9bc/gease-0.0.1-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"8bbe1c23b824164b8d6972488242322d", "sha256": "72f839f1ebddc80ff3b7ea5ce90be96b284e7d1b45df060646ba6e6b5b6f9909" }, "downloads": -1, "filename": "gease-0.0.1.tar.gz", "has_sig": false, "md5_digest": "8bbe1c23b824164b8d6972488242322d",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5721, "upload_time": "2017-10-13T20:40:25", "url": "https://files.pythonhosted.org/packages/ac/97/659a4afc8fcbf953895a33ad5f6f12400e42f4be0ec883095ea9e8ff4d15/gease-0.0.1.tar.gz" } ], "0.0.2": [ { "comment_text": "", "digests": { "md5": "7368cd2118cf38beff45bd3e1b2bddfc", "sha256": "3051efba4016392cb5a8687347374d8607ac5d12f7c73c07535366064649d16c" }, "downloads": -1, "filename": "gease-0.0.2-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"7368cd2118cf38beff45bd3e1b2bddfc", "packagetype": "bdist_wheel", "python_version": "3.5", "requires_python": null, "size": 8705, "upload_time": "2017-10-14T23:53:05", "url": "https://files.pythonhosted.org/packages/28/21/1ac7ca3bafbce9edf357cd224631c0f84db78107fdc6c6d6ea9d71f6abd1/gease-0.0.2-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"f50ec0406185d8aff52a0779b6184cd8", "sha256": "8af17b572c54d88d061e2b5f2bd47ad3cd951ccbc06537b676b2dacb07530858" }, "downloads": -1, "filename": "gease-0.0.2.tar.gz", "has_sig": false, "md5_digest": "f50ec0406185d8aff52a0779b6184cd8",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6247, "upload_time": "2017-10-14T23:53:04", "url": "https://files.pythonhosted.org/packages/3e/ea/4696a6e9d5dd2a02d1c90caead4bb08080bb997791638a53d4edab83c90e/gease-0.0.2.tar.gz" } ], "0.0.3": [ { "comment_text": "", "digests": { "md5": "d3cddfe02ed78ced9e8e4e5f884067a0", "sha256": "57bb6b555945dcc48fb18b1a845b70ca9b3fe7e0367f055d7c96e6038d4733ea" }, "downloads": -1, "filename": "gease-0.0.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"d3cddfe02ed78ced9e8e4e5f884067a0",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 10737, "upload_time": "2017-11-25T09:35:04", "url": "https://files.pythonhosted.org/packages/c3/ba/d3c1a0dbbb0a3ca95b4c62c93e9c2982560bc1aee8cd2cecbc4a2081cede/gease-0.0.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"61cd291e42a53ffda9e65412b10a1224", "sha256": "e6e5427b52a17234eb7564f32ba5525372538813675f2dc07125181cc2be84e7" }, "downloads": -1, "filename": "gease-0.0.3.tar.gz", "has_sig": false, "md5_digest": "61cd291e42a53ffda9e65412b10a1224",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7232, "upload_time": "2017-11-25T09:35:03", "url": "https://files.pythonhosted.org/packages/45/78/5afea957f2b034952b1753543bad922945945cef9d64c2533730d9241424/gease-0.0.3.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"d3cddfe02ed78ced9e8e4e5f884067a0", "sha256": "57bb6b555945dcc48fb18b1a845b70ca9b3fe7e0367f055d7c96e6038d4733ea" }, "downloads": -1, "filename": "gease-0.0.3-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"d3cddfe02ed78ced9e8e4e5f884067a0", "packagetype": "bdist_wheel", "python_version": "2.7", "requires_python": null, "size": 10737, "upload_time": "2017-11-25T09:35:04", "url": "https://files.pythonhosted.org/packages/c3/ba/d3c1a0dbbb0a3ca95b4c62c93e9c2982560bc1aee8cd2cecbc4a2081cede/gease-0.0.3-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"61cd291e42a53ffda9e65412b10a1224", "sha256": "e6e5427b52a17234eb7564f32ba5525372538813675f2dc07125181cc2be84e7" }, "downloads": -1, "filename": "gease-0.0.3.tar.gz", "has_sig": false, "md5_digest": "61cd291e42a53ffda9e65412b10a1224",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 7232, "upload_time": "2017-11-25T09:35:03", "url": "https://files.pythonhosted.org/packages/45/78/5afea957f2b034952b1753543bad922945945cef9d64c2533730d9241424/gease-0.0.3.tar.gz" } ] }